In Bradbury’s modern Gothic masterpiece, two young boys confront a dark and sinister presence lurking in their world…and in themselves.

 

On the crest of the wind one autumn night, something evil arrives in the small Midwestern town where Jim Nightshade and Will Holloway have grown up side by side. As the stroke of midnight marks the boys’ thirteenth birthday, a dark carnival creaks into place, waiting. Frightening, yet seductive, the carnival’s supernatural attractions contain an awful mystery. Led by the mysterious ringmaster Mr. Dark, the Pandemonium Shadow Show promises to grant your deepest wish—for a price. Can Will and Jim save the souls of the town…and their own?

 

With haunting, resonant language and imagery, Bradbury creates an inimitable atmosphere of dread and wonder.

Ray Bradbury, one of the most popular science fiction writers in the world, is the author of more than five hundred short stories, novels, plays, and poems. He has won many awards, including the National Book Award and the Grand Master Award from the Science Fiction and Fantasy Writers of America.
